打印

程序下载不进去,郁闷死了,STC

[复制链接]
9398|3
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
mxinfa|  楼主 | 2009-11-10 21:45 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
使用的是STC12LE5410AD,前几天我不在实验室,一个学生先焊了一块,然后打电话告诉我,程序下载不进去,因为这块板子是新做的,电话中也说不清楚,项目催的急,我直接让他用老板子重新焊了一块(老板子手里还剩了几块),可以正常工作,第二天我去了以后,判断单片机已经坏掉了,让学生换了一片单片机,第一次可以下载进去,工作不正常,然后再也下载不进去了,然后学生告诉我第一片也是这种情况,手里这个单片机恰好用完了,就又买了10片,新单片机换上情况有所变化,下载过程可以开始,但擦除不了原来的程序,每次下载都失败,但原来里面的程序还在正常运行(STC系列的单片机出厂的时候里面是有程序的,引脚高低电平变化,我有个引脚上接了LED),我电脑上的isp版本3.9的,换了个4.8的版本,程序可以下了,问题一样,下了一次就再也下载不进去了,把阻容、晶振、MAX3232几乎全换了一遍还是不行,图中的那个U3也拆掉了。实在没办法了,今天又重新焊了一块,只焊了最小系统和MAX3232电路,还是一样的情况,下载过程可以开始到了擦除程序的地方就擦除不了,没敢再用新的ISP版本,咱也是唯物主义者啊,这个事情基本确认肯定是自己的板子的问题了,但新板子与老板子相比仅仅是图中的U3我往右挪了大约1CM,原来U3不靠边,结构不太好做。跟原来的板子一根线一根线比较,没有任何不同,老板子已用在了5、6台产品上了,也都很好,我们这是小地方,做的这个东西也比较贵,有5、6台的订单已经很不错了,这块板子只是其中很小的一部分。哎,郁闷死了,STC系列的单片机用了不少了,没出过什么问题,可以被项目难死,不能被项目恶心死啊,大家帮我看看,谢谢了,不知道有没有没有遇到跟我一样的问题,我PCB的局部贴出来,图中F1即STC12LE5410AD,U5为MAX3232,其余什么东西都没焊上

相关帖子

沙发
duojinian| | 2009-11-11 12:16 | 只看该作者
1。isp烧录占用的引脚,最好不好使用,如果使用,请串接电阻再和其他应用电路连接。
2。做个手动复位按钮,在烧录器上,烧录不进去,可能是芯片没有准备好。多复位几次看看。
3。尽可能缩短烧录线。最好用有屏蔽层的烧录线。

使用特权

评论回复
板凳
mxinfa|  楼主 | 2009-11-11 14:11 | 只看该作者
谢谢
stc就是用的串口烧录,板子上用跳线帽选择的,下载完了之后再跳到别的功能上去

使用特权

评论回复
地板
mxinfa|  楼主 | 2009-11-11 20:46 | 只看该作者
又折腾一下午,死马当做活马医,最后我把我电脑中的ISP软件从3.91升级到了4.80(前面提到过在学生的电脑上试过4.80版,成功一次就再也下载不了了,但他的是绿色版的,我用的安装版的),抱着必死的决心下载了一次,嘿,下载成功,再来一次,还是成功,连续试了十几次都是成功,全当问题解决了吧!
总结:下载软件尽量用正式版里面的最高版本的,另外尽量用安装版(这个问题宏晶公司也是建议用安装版),不要用绿色版
附带:今天下午在调试的时候翻箱倒柜找了一片直插的MAX3232,结果焊好之后发现,只有把电压调到4.9V以上,才能工作在1200的波特率下,调到5.2V才能工作在4800下,爷爷的,什么世道,换了一片MAX232,竟然在2.8V的时候还能在9600波特率下工作,真出了鬼了,全是用的国产芯片

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

33

主题

198

帖子

1

粉丝